    Who is Dr. Vetter, Family Medicine Specialist in West Fargo, ND?

    Dr. Richard Vetter, MD is a Family Medicine Specialist, who primarily practices in West Fargo, ND with 2 additional practice locations. He is board certified by the American Board of Family Medicine. Dr. Vetter graduated from University of North Dakota School of Medicine and Health Sciences and completed his residency at St Luke'S Hosp, Family Medicine; Univ Nd Affil Hosp, Family Medicine. Dr. Vetter is fluent in English, and is not currently seeing new patients. Dr. Vetter’s practice accepts Medicare and other major insurance plans.     Is this Dr. Richard Vetter aff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Vetter is affiliated with Essentia Health-Fargo which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
